Ed Moses has been a prominent figure in the Los Angeles art scene for almost six decades. Born in 1926 in Long Beach, CA, Moses studied art at UCLA, and trained under the expressionist painter, Rico Lebrun. He first exhibited work in 1949, and was part of the original group of artists from the legendary Ferus Gallery in 1957. The Ferus Gallery was founded by artist Edward Kienholz and curator Walter Hopps - it was the first gallery on the west coast to devote a solo show to Andy Warhol. Ferus Gallery marked Los Angeles as a major contender in the international art scene, promoting LA-unique movements, such as Light and Space and Finish Fetish. Moses had his first solo exhibition at Ferus Gallery in 1958. Moses’ career was the subject of a major retrospective at the Museum of Contemporary Art in 1996, and his art was featured in the Pompidou Center’s survey exhibition ''Los Angeles: Birth of an Artistic Capital, 1955-1985'' in Paris. In 2015, the Los Angeles County Museum of Art mounted a solo exhibition of his works on paper from the 1960 and 70s. Always working with process and experimenting with materials as a painter, Moses has been critically lauded for his bold composition and innovation. At over 80 years old, he remains a prolific fixture of the Los Angeles art scene, and is respected for his inventiveness as an artist and his attentiveness to new developments in contemporary art.
